Today's Identity Crisis, and the Identity Metasystem
By: Stefan Brands


Stefan Brands presented on a panel on identity at Microsoft's MIX06 conference, Las Vegas, March 20-22, 2006.  The panel, titled "Today's Identity Crisis, and the Identity Metasystem", discussed Microsoft's vision for the Identity Metasystem, a framework for a new internet-level identity system proposed by Microsoft and industry partners, which addresses the challenges users face with online security, identity theft, and the complexity of managing multiple identities.  Dr. Brands' presentation, with an introduction from Microsoft's Kim Cameron, is available for download here.
